Четверг, 25 Апреля 2024, 01:14

Приветствую Вас Гость

[ Новые сообщения · Игроделы · Правила · Поиск ]
  • Страница 2 из 3
  • «
  • 1
  • 2
  • 3
  • »
Форум игроделов » Записи участника » Farcuat [46]
Результаты поиска
FarcuatДата: Суббота, 06 Апреля 2013, 12:20 | Сообщение # 21 | Тема: Завершена работа программы...
частый гость
Сейчас нет на сайте
А он случайно не самого себя создает?
FarcuatДата: Пятница, 05 Апреля 2013, 20:43 | Сообщение # 22 | Тема: Эвенты на с++ или как это назвать
частый гость
Сейчас нет на сайте
100 это даже много. Тот же телепорт в город1 и телепорт в город2 это же не 2 разных евента.
FarcuatДата: Пятница, 05 Апреля 2013, 19:30 | Сообщение # 23 | Тема: Эвенты на с++ или как это назвать
частый гость
Сейчас нет на сайте
Цитата (Animan2010)
чтобы реализовать большое количество таких событий, лучше создавать производные классы, от класса эвент?

Нет, наследование тут лишне. Я бы сделал проще, и тебе советую. Заводишь в классе переменную тип_ивента и в апдейте прыгаешь свичем на нужный кусок кода. А уж в нем хочешь длл, хочешь скрипты вызывай, хочешь тупо код пропиши (это к чему душа лежит) и все.
Наследование используй чтобы из банана сделать самолет, а если нужены лимон или яблоко, то достаточно поменять спрайт(это образно выражаясь).
FarcuatДата: Четверг, 28 Марта 2013, 12:01 | Сообщение # 24 | Тема: Проблемы с интерфейсом управления
частый гость
Сейчас нет на сайте
Конструкция выглядит криво. Срабатывает строчка 1, после нее сразу срабатывает строчка 4. Попробуй через switch сделать.

FarcuatДата: Суббота, 09 Марта 2013, 17:01 | Сообщение # 25 | Тема: WT 2D
частый гость
Сейчас нет на сайте
Очень понравились деревья. Хочу позаимствовать идею)
FarcuatДата: Воскресенье, 03 Марта 2013, 12:14 | Сообщение # 26 | Тема: Как заставить генератор работать при рестарте
частый гость
Сейчас нет на сайте
part_emitter_region - второй параметр эмиттер а не тип частиц.

Исправив это все заработает даже при рестарте, но фактически будут создаваться новые системы частиц и все остальное. Вот выдержка из справки.
Цитата
Системы частицы будут жить всегда после того, как они были созданы. Так, даже если Вы изменяете комнату или повторно начинаете игру, системы и частицы остаются. Так что удостоверьтесь лучше в их уничтожении, как только Вы больше в них не нуждаетесь.
FarcuatДата: Воскресенье, 03 Марта 2013, 02:28 | Сообщение # 27 | Тема: Как заставить генератор работать при рестарте
частый гость
Сейчас нет на сайте
Ты размещаешь object3 в новой комнате? Не нужно.

А при рестарте игры попробуй удалить систему частиц вручную.
object3 событие game end:
part_system_destroy(sist)
part_type_destroy(tip)
FarcuatДата: Пятница, 22 Февраля 2013, 10:36 | Сообщение # 28 | Тема: Вопрос - Ответ (Game Maker)
частый гость
Сейчас нет на сайте
В критерии остановки if(distance_to_point(cover_x, cover_y) < 5). Или что угодно со значками <>. А с таким оператором == будет перепрыгивать.
FarcuatДата: Среда, 20 Февраля 2013, 00:31 | Сообщение # 29 | Тема: Float в LPCTSTR и обратно.
частый гость
Сейчас нет на сайте
Попробуй в предпоследней строчке sizeof(textBuffer) заменить на 32.
FarcuatДата: Вторник, 17 Апреля 2012, 23:10 | Сообщение # 30 | Тема: Путман
частый гость
Сейчас нет на сайте
Так ведь он же и бегает. Конечно плохо разобрать но все же...
FarcuatДата: Вторник, 17 Апреля 2012, 23:04 | Сообщение # 31 | Тема: Путман
частый гость
Сейчас нет на сайте
С интерфейсом закончил. Все необходимые индикаторы присутствуют.
Новый скриншот


romgerman, ок учту, только напиши подробнее на что особенно следует обратить внимание. Конкретные спрайты или общая яркость/бледность?


Сообщение отредактировал Farcuat - Вторник, 17 Апреля 2012, 23:07
FarcuatДата: Вторник, 17 Апреля 2012, 20:12 | Сообщение # 32 | Тема: Путман
частый гость
Сейчас нет на сайте
MyACT Да идея похожая.

Deniiel На счет ремейка, не могу сказать однозначно, сам плохо понимаю, где проходит граница между ремейком и похожей игрой.

Но, что касается геймплея – он другой. В этой игре есть изменяемый игроком лабиринт (разрушаемые блоки). Есть закрытые области, попасть в которые можно, только используя суперудар гг. То есть игрок может сам решать, когда открыть определенные участки/проходы.
Вдобавок к этому необходимо следить за уровнем накопленной энергии. Только благодаря ей гг может использовать суперудар. А ведь это еще и способ борьбы с врагами. И перед каждым использованием нужно будет принимать решение: пробить блок, чтобы открыть дорогу или избавиться от врага, который подобрался достаточно близко.
FarcuatДата: Понедельник, 16 Апреля 2012, 21:27 | Сообщение # 33 | Тема: Путман
частый гость
Сейчас нет на сайте
Название: Путман
Жанр: Аркада
Код: С++
Пространство: 2D
Вид: Сверху

Сюжет: Во время третьей мировой войны ВВП укрылся в бункере. По несчастью это оказался бункер с ядерными отходами. К удивлению он не погиб от радиации, а мутировал в Путмана, приобретя сверхспособности – огромную силу и скорость. Его героические способности требуют подвигов, и Путман выходит на борьбу с местными тварями.

Описание: Задача героя полностью исследовать лабиринт, собрав все радиоактивные вещи. Прикосновение к врагу означает смерть. Накопившуюся радиацию Путман использует для сверхспособности. В такой момент враг, оказавшийся у него на пути погибает. Не выдерживают этого удара и некоторые стены.

Скриншоты:


17.04.2012


21.04.2012


Что уже сделано:
- есть вся игровая физика.
- есть меню, подсчет очков после уровня, загрузка нового уровня.
- есть спрайты основных игровых объектов, включая гг (можно видеть на скринах).
- есть несколько звуков для основных действий.

Нужно доделать:
- спрайты врагов (на скринах пока красные человечки). (21.04.2012)
- работа с интерфейсом (шкала радиации, возможно, переделаю вид Жизней).
- добавить много звуков. (21.04.2012)
- отображение некоторых эффектов (появление врага, и т.д.) (21.04.2012)


Сообщение отредактировал Farcuat - Суббота, 21 Апреля 2012, 16:42
FarcuatДата: Вторник, 29 Марта 2011, 11:51 | Сообщение # 34 | Тема: Дайте, пожалуйста, совет по графике
частый гость
Сейчас нет на сайте
scripto, в любом случае необходим универсальный класс для хранения сетки. Храни в нем список вершин и список ребер (или полигонов). Такому классу будет все равно, какую форму он хранит. Далее, если нужно поведение как у отдельных объектов делаешь 3 экземпляра класса, если это не нужно, храни в одном.
FarcuatДата: Вторник, 22 Февраля 2011, 20:00 | Сообщение # 35 | Тема: Исправьте пожалуйста код для DirectX.
частый гость
Сейчас нет на сайте
Morglod, буфер не создан.

у тебя после

Code
if (FAILED(pDirect3D->CreateDevice(D3DADAPTER_DEFAULT, // используемая видеокарта  

сразу идет
Code
pDirect3DDevice->CreateVertexBuffer

а должно между ними быть

Code
return E_FAIL;

которое в первом варианте у тебя внизу неприкаянное скучало.
FarcuatДата: Среда, 09 Февраля 2011, 13:00 | Сообщение # 36 | Тема: Проблемы с мышью
частый гость
Сейчас нет на сайте
аТнОтХоАн, была такая же проблема с множественным кликом. Скорее всего, мышь попросту сточилась. Разбери ее и посмотри на ударную часть клавиш. У меня было так, что на кнопку из более твердого пластика била часть клавиши из более мягкого пластика. В результате в ней выточилась колея. Можно нагреть зажигалкой и сровнять ударную поверхность клавиши.
FarcuatДата: Понедельник, 31 Января 2011, 13:15 | Сообщение # 37 | Тема: Вычисление объема части корабля находящейся в воде.
частый гость
Сейчас нет на сайте
Допустим, знаешь вес корабля. “Вес плавающего тела равен весу вытесняемой им жидкости” и у тебя известен вес воды. Придумываешь воде плотность, и у тебя будет известен объем, который и будет объемом подводной части корабля smile .
FarcuatДата: Среда, 26 Января 2011, 11:48 | Сообщение # 38 | Тема: Windows заблокирован - троян-баннер
частый гость
Сейчас нет на сайте
Quote (IroNN)
да да. сегодня автозагрузку смотрел, такое было. только стереть никак. где реестр смотреть?

Через "Пуск->Выполнить->regedit", далее по тем путям. В каталоге "Run" будет много полезного. Удалить нужно только одну строчку, которая запускает блокиратор (если она вообще там есть). Если хочешь выкладывай скрин того, что в нем прописано сюда, попробуем определить.

FarcuatДата: Вторник, 25 Января 2011, 16:44 | Сообщение # 39 | Тема: Windows заблокирован - троян-баннер
частый гость
Сейчас нет на сайте
IroNN, эта зараза могла прописаться в реестре в автозапуск. Если это так, будет мучить тебя постоянно.

Пути в реестре такие:
HKEY_CURRENT_USER\SoftWare\Microsoft\Windows\CurrentVersion\Run
HKEY_LOCAL_MACHINE\SoftWare\Microsoft\Windows\CurrentVersion\Run

Если найдешь ее там, стирай. И екзешник тоже. Путь к нему будет указан.

После этого у тебя останется уже загруженная копия в памяти. Поэтому, либо делаешь экстренную перезагрузку (типа отключение света smile ), чтобы не успела себя снова прописать. Либо, те же действия, но в безопасном режиме винды.

Сообщение отредактировал Farcuat - Вторник, 25 Января 2011, 16:51
FarcuatДата: Четверг, 13 Января 2011, 10:47 | Сообщение # 40 | Тема: Автофизика.
частый гость
Сейчас нет на сайте
GECK, видеть еще нечего, одна моделька ездит по почти пустому экрану.
Если нужен сам класс, дай майл вышлю. Сюда не запостить, большой вышел biggrin .
Форум игроделов » Записи участника » Farcuat [46]
  • Страница 2 из 3
  • «
  • 1
  • 2
  • 3
  • »
Поиск:

Все права сохранены. GcUp.ru © 2008-2024 Рейтинг